日韩在线电影_国产不卡在线_久久99精品久久久久久国产越南_欧美激情一区二区三区_国产一区二区三区亚洲_国产在线高清

當前位置 主頁 > 技術大全 >

    Weka在Linux Shell中的高效應用技巧
    weka linux shell

    欄目:技術大全 時間:2024-12-10 10:36



    探索Weka在Linux Shell下的強大功能與應用 在當今的數(shù)據(jù)科學領域,數(shù)據(jù)挖掘和機器學習技術扮演著至關重要的角色

        作為這些技術中的佼佼者,Weka不僅以其豐富的算法庫、用戶友好的圖形界面而著稱,更因其強大的命令行工具成為數(shù)據(jù)科學家和分析師們不可或缺的工具之一

        尤其是在Linux環(huán)境下,通過shell腳本調用Weka,可以極大地提升數(shù)據(jù)處理和分析的效率與靈活性

        本文將深入探討如何在Linux shell中高效利用Weka,展現(xiàn)其無與倫比的功能與優(yōu)勢

         一、Weka簡介 Weka(全名是Waikato Environment for Knowledge Analysis)是由新西蘭懷卡托大學開發(fā)的一款開源數(shù)據(jù)挖掘軟件

        它集成了眾多經典的機器學習算法,包括分類、回歸、聚類、關聯(lián)規(guī)則挖掘及可視化等,并支持多種數(shù)據(jù)格式,如ARFF(Attribute-Relation File Format)、CSV等

        Weka不僅提供了易于上手的圖形用戶界面(GUI),還配備了功能強大的命令行界面(CLI),使得用戶能夠在腳本中自動化執(zhí)行復雜的數(shù)據(jù)分析任務

         二、在Linux Shell中安裝Weka 在Linux系統(tǒng)上安裝Weka非常簡單

        用戶可以通過以下幾種方式獲取Weka: 1.直接下載JAR文件:訪問Weka官方網站,下載最新版本的weka.jar文件

        這是Weka的核心文件,包含了所有功能

         2.使用包管理器:某些Linux發(fā)行版的軟件倉庫中可能已經包含了Weka,如Ubuntu的APT包管理器中可以通過`sudo apt-get installweka`直接安裝

         3.從源代碼編譯:對于追求最新特性或有特殊需求的用戶,可以從Weka的GitHub倉庫克隆代碼并自行編譯

         安裝完成后,用戶可以通過命令行運行Weka,例如使用`java -jar weka.jar`啟動GUI界面,或者利用`java -cp weka.jar weka.classifiers.Classifier`等命令執(zhí)行特定的機器學習任務

         三、Linux Shell下的Weka操作基礎 在Linux shell中,Weka的命令行工具允許用戶以腳本化的方式執(zhí)行各種操作,包括但不限于數(shù)據(jù)預處理、模型訓練和評估

        以下是一些基礎操作的示例: 1.數(shù)據(jù)預處理: 使用`ConverterUtils.DataSource`類可以加載數(shù)據(jù),并通過`Filter`進行預處理

        例如,將CSV文件轉換為ARFF格式,并應用歸一化操作: bash java -cp weka.jar weka.core.converters.ConverterUtils.DataSource -r input.csv -arff -o output.arff java -cp weka.jar weka.filters.unsupervised.attribute.Normalize -R first-last -i output.arff -o normalized.arff 2.模型訓練: 使用`Classifier`類可以訓練模型

        例如,使用J48決策樹算法對歸一化后的數(shù)據(jù)進行訓練: bash java -cp weka.jar weka.classifiers.trees.J48 -t normalized.arff -d model.model 3.模型評估: 訓練完成后,可以使用`Evaluator`類對模型進行評估

        例如,評估之前訓練的J48模型在測試集上的性能: bash java -cp weka.jar weka.classifiers.Evaluation -l model.model -T test.arff -c last 四、高級應用:自動化工作流程與批量處理

主站蜘蛛池模板: 久久精品视频网站 | 亚洲国产色视频 | 91精品国产综合久久久久久丝袜 | av不卡在线播放 | 久久久精品国产 | 免费亚洲婷婷 | 久久网页 | 亚洲免费视频一区 | 欧美日韩在线免费观看 | 免费人成黄页网站在线一区二区 | 国产亚洲欧美一区 | 黄久久久 | 久久久久久久久久久久久av | 国产精品久久久久免费 | 欧美精品久久 | 一级高清| 欧美在线 | 亚洲 | 久久久久av69精品 | 亚洲精品日韩在线 | 国产日产精品一区二区三区四区 | 国产a级大片 | 国产高清无密码一区二区三区 | 精品少妇一区二区三区在线播放 | 免费激情网站 | 国产资源在线播放 | 国产欧美综合一区二区三区 | 亚洲一区av | av电影资源 | 日韩一区二 | 成人午夜电影网 | 激情久久久 | 涩涩视频在线免费看 | 欧美在线免费观看 | 午夜精品久久久久久久久 | 国产一区二区三区在线 | 日本久久精品视频 | 欧美成人黄色小视频 | 国产中文字幕在线播放 | 日韩欧美中文字幕在线视频 | 99久久99久久久精品色圆 | 国产一区高清 |